During the creation of a [[new character]], you are given several options to customize your character. This takes place as soon as you enter Arelith for the first time on a new character in the character creation area, which is considered to be an [[OOC]] area.

Customization options include [[Race|subrace]] selection, selection of any [[Class|subclasses or paths]], and the selection of [[Character creation#Gifts|gifts]] for your character.
 
== Subraces ==
 
{{Main|Race}}
 
Subraces in Arelith do not affect the stats or abilities of the character (any more). The selection only affects the appearance, starting location, starting languages, and factions.
 
== Paths ==
Depending on your starting class, you have the option to select one of seven [[paths]] for your character to follow. Selecting a path modifies the features of your characters class, giving them some abilities and taking others away.
 
== Gifts ==
 
The [[gifts]] system is a mechanic unique to Arelith that allows you to customize your character. You can select up to three of the gifts for each new character, and gifts cannot be selected after leaving the character creation area. Each gift applies a bonus or malus to a particular ability, along with applying an [[ECL]].
 
== Background ==
 
A new character may be assigned a [[background]] that affects the starting abilities of the character. Each background provides a bonus to some abilities and a malus to others, with the exception of the fisherman background, which lets the character start with a [[fishin' pole]] (medium races) or fishin' pole jr. (small or tiny races).
